Former Federal Reserve Chair Alan Greenspan has endorsed the nationalization of struggling US banks. In an interview with the Financial Times, Greenspan said, “It may be necessary to temporarily nationalize some banks in order to facilitate a swift and orderly restructuring. I understand that once in a hundred years this is what you do.” Greenspan’s embrace of neoliberal policies during his Fed tenure has been criticized for helping to cause today’s financial crisis.
